雙11購物節不僅是消費者的狂歡,更是對企業技術架構的年度大考。面對流量洪峰、交易并發與系統穩定性的多重挑戰,構建一個彈性、高可用的云架構已成為企業制勝的關鍵。本文將深入探討在雙11背景下,企業應如何調整和優化其云架構,并充分利用專業的技術服務,確保大促平穩度過。
一、 雙11技術挑戰的核心:彈性與穩定
雙11的流量特征呈現典型的“脈沖式”爆發,峰值可達日常的數十倍甚至上百倍。傳統固定資源池的架構難以應對,極易導致系統過載、服務雪崩。因此,云架構的核心任務從“支撐穩態”轉變為“應對浪涌”。關鍵在于實現資源的秒級彈性伸縮,確保在流量到來時快速擴容,在峰值過后及時縮容以控制成本。
二、 企業云架構的“正確姿勢”
- 架構解耦與微服務化:將單體應用拆分為獨立部署、可伸縮的微服務。例如,將用戶、商品、訂單、支付等核心模塊分離,避免單一模塊故障引發全局癱瘓。結合容器化技術(如Docker+Kubernetes),實現服務的快速部署與彈性管理。
- 多層次彈性策略:
- 計算彈性:依托云廠商的自動伸縮組(Auto Scaling),根據CPU、內存、網絡流量或自定義業務指標(如QPS、訂單量)動態調整ECS實例或容器副本數量。
- 存儲彈性:采用高吞吐、低延遲的云數據庫(如PolarDB、Redis云服務)并開啟讀寫分離、分庫分表。對象存儲(OSS)應對海量圖片、靜態資源訪問。
- 網絡彈性:使用全球加速、負載均衡(SLB)和彈性公網IP,智能調度流量,抵御DDoS攻擊,保障網絡通路的高可用與低延遲。
- 全鏈路壓測與預案:在真實環境進行全鏈路壓力測試,模擬峰值流量,暴露瓶頸。必須制定詳細的降級、限流和熔斷預案。非核心服務(如商品評價、推薦算法)可設置降級開關,在極限情況下保障核心交易鏈路的通暢。
- 可觀測性體系:建立涵蓋指標(Metrics)、日志(Logs)、鏈路追蹤(Traces)的立體監控體系。通過業務大盤實時洞察核心交易轉化率、系統健康度,實現問題快速定位與止損。
三、 技術服務:從工具到保障的核心支撐
再優秀的架構也離不開專業、及時的技術服務支撐。在雙11期間,企業應善用云廠商及第三方提供的技術服務:
- 專家護航服務:許多云服務商提供大促護航套餐,由架構師、研發工程師組成的專家團隊提前介入,進行架構巡檢、方案評審,并在大促期間提供7x24小時現場或遠程保障,協助應急處理。
- 性能優化服務:針對數據庫慢SQL、JVM性能調優、代碼級瓶頸等,利用專業工具和專家經驗進行深度優化,榨取每一分系統性能。
- 安全防護服務:啟用Web應用防火墻(WAF)、安全應急響應等服務,應對薅羊毛、爬蟲、數據泄露等安全威脅,保障業務與數據安全。
- 成本優化咨詢:通過資源預留實例、按量付費組合、閑時縮容等策略,在保障性能的前提下,實現精細化成本控制,避免“狂歡后的賬單驚嚇”。
四、 技術為業務賦能
雙11的云架構備戰,是一場系統工程。正確的姿勢是:以彈性伸縮為骨架,以微服務和云原生技術為肌體,以全鏈路壓測和預案為神經,以立體監控為眼睛。而專業的技術服務,則是貫穿始終的“保健醫生”和“急救團隊”,為企業提供從規劃、實施到護航的全周期保障。最終目標是讓技術隱形,讓業務流暢運行,在銷售額創下新高的用戶體驗與系統穩定性也贏得口碑。唯有如此,企業才能在一年一度的技術大考中交出滿意答卷,并為未來的數字化增長奠定堅實基礎。